Is Beauty “in the Eye of the Beholder?”

Surprisingly psychologists say “No” Strong agreement on what is considered

“beautiful” in facial photograph ratings across genders and across cultures

Therefore beauty can be measured (objectively)!

Is Beauty in the Eye of the Employer?

Extensive research on beauty in social psychology and human resource management

In economics, Hamermesh and Biddle (1994) “Beauty Premium” Establish that looks matter even after controlling for

many observable characteristics (actual labor market experience, years of tenure in a firm, union status, firm size, race, geographic location, fathers' occupation, childhood background, immigrant status of respondents and their parents and grandparents)

Experimental Design

Employees were “hired” to perform a skilled task of solving Yahoo! mazes for 15 minutes.

Before interviews they had a chance to solve a practice maze of level “Easy”

During employment period they solved mazes one level of difficulty higher

Experimental Design

We would not expect beauty to be directly productive for this task. We can therefore focus on worker/employer interaction alone

The task requires true skill. Gneezy, Niederle and Rustichini (2003) have shown that there is considerable variation in skill and speed of learning for performing this task.

Why Mazes?Why Mazes?

Page 19: Why Beauty Matters An Experimental Investigation Markus Mobius (Harvard University) Tanya Rosenblat (Wesleyan University) November 2004

Experimental Design Neither worker nor employer have well defined

focal points for predicting future performance if presented with the practice time.

There is a significant amount of learning possible in performing this task during the allocated 15 min time period. This allows for overconfidence effects and also for

true persuasion: a confident worker might truly believe that she can solve many mazes even though she did poorly in the practice round, and possibly can convince the employer to believe her.

Page 20: Why Beauty Matters An Experimental Investigation Markus Mobius (Harvard University) Tanya Rosenblat (Wesleyan University) November 2004

Experimental Design

Playing the main game at the next level of difficulty opens room for additional uncertainty and thus further over-confidence and persuasion effects.

Experimental Design

Each worker is asked to form an estimate of how many mazes she will be able to solve in 15 minutes

This information is only provided for the experimenter and is not revealed to the employers.

Compensation is structured in an incentive compatible manner to induce workers to truthfully reveal their estimates.

Workers and employers complete a control questionnaire to make sure they understand how payments are calculated.

Experimental Design

Treatment A: Resume only without a facial photograph.

Treatment B: Resume and facial photograph. Treatment C: Resume without a photograph and

oral telephone communication. Treatment D: Resume with a facial photograph

and oral telephone communication. Treatment E: Resume with a facial photograph

and face-to-face interview.

Each worker participates in 5 treatments in random order:Each worker participates in 5 treatments in random order:

Compensation of Workers:

Workers get a piece rate of 100 points for each

maze they solve during 15 min work period

Workers get a “wage” determined by each

employer. (used 80% of the time; 20% of the

time the wage is set by the experimenter)

all wages are paid by the experimenter.

40 points are subtracted from worker’s compensation for each maze they mispredict (above or below their estimate). This provides a marginal incentive of 60 points per maze to continue solving mazes even after they hit their estimate.

Compensation of Employers:

Employers get a fixed fee of 4000

points

Regardless of whether employer wage is used or not 40 points are subtracted from employer’s compensation for each maze they mispredict (above or below their estimate for each employee).

Experimental Design

By a panel of 50 independent evaluators on a scale from 1 to 5

1 - homely, far below average in attractiveness; 2 - plain, below average in attractiveness; 3 - of average beauty; 4 - above-average; and 5 - strikingly handsome or beautiful.

Standard passport-type photographs were presented to evaluators in random order via a website.

Subjects

Undergraduate and masters students from Tucuman University, Argentina

instructions in Spanish delivered orally and via a computer

subjects completed a control questionnaire to ensure understanding of compensation schemes

33 sessions of 5 workers and 5 employers each worker being reviewed by 5 employers (825 observations)

Page 37: Why Beauty Matters An Experimental Investigation Markus Mobius (Harvard University) Tanya Rosenblat (Wesleyan University) November 2004

Subjects

Subjects were paid 12 pesos for participation + additional earnings described above

Average earnings 25 pesos for an experiment of up to one and a half hours in length.

Made sure subjects did not know each other prior to the experiment.

Average Performance:

The mean number of mazes solved was 9.5 (10.9 for men; 7.8 for women)

The average maze during 15 minute trial took 94 sec; the average practice time was 127 sec

Subjects systematically underestimated their own productivity by 24% on average.

Employers underestimated workers’ productivity in a similar manner (20% on average).

Beauty Measure

Measurement error arises because each rater has a distinct definition of “baseline” beauty

Formally, for each rater we take her average beauty rating and subtract it from each raw rating for subject in order to define the centered rating

The measure BEAUTY for subject is then defined as the mean over all raters’ centered ratings.

Beauty and Ability After controlling for all labor market

characteristics, find no evidence of a relationship between actual ability during 15 min work period and physical attractiveness.

There is also no evidence of a relationship between projected ability using practice time and physical attractiveness.

Therefore, a beauty premium in this setting is NOT a (maze-solving) skill premium!

Page 45: Why Beauty Matters An Experimental Investigation Markus Mobius (Harvard University) Tanya Rosenblat (Wesleyan University) November 2004

Confidence and Beauty

There is a strongly significant (at the 1 percent level) effect of physical attractiveness on confidence. Raising beauty by one standard deviation increases confidence about 13%.

This effect is very large: if we define a ‘beautiful’ person to be one standard deviation above the mean and a ‘plain’ person to be one standard deviation below then the plain subject is about 26% less confident than the beautiful subject.

Interestingly, there is no difference in confidence between men and women in this setting (once we control for actual ability).

Page 46: Why Beauty Matters An Experimental Investigation Markus Mobius (Harvard University) Tanya Rosenblat (Wesleyan University) November 2004

Wage regressions (w/o confidence)

Regressions of wages on workers’ characteristics including BEAUTY but excluding CONFIDENCE. (Separate regression for each treatment). First of all, there is a beauty premium in our

experiment in all treatments except A ranging from 12 to 17% with CV controls.

There is no evidence for direct taste-based Becker-type discrimination

Page 47: Why Beauty Matters An Experimental Investigation Markus Mobius (Harvard University) Tanya Rosenblat (Wesleyan University) November 2004

Wage Regressions (w/ Confidence Controls)

Same as regressions before but with an additional control for confidence. As expected, confident subjects only do better in

treatments with oral communication. A 1% increase in confidence raises wages by about

0.18 to 0.33%. The beauty effects in treatments C to E are smaller by

about 2 to 4%. This decline is consistent because we know that one standard deviation in beauty increases confidence by about 13%.

Pooled Regression: Visual Stereotype Channel - 7.2% wage

gain for each standard deviation in beauty Oral Stereotype Channel - 10.4% wage

gain for each standard deviation in beauty Confidence Channel - raises wage by .3%

for each 1% increase in confidence. This translates into 3.6% increase in wage for one standard deviation increase in beauty

Policy Implications Job interviews are currently the most common method of

employee selection. Direct discrimination can be minimized by reducing face-to-

face interactions and relying on telephone interviews instead or hard data like test scores.

For example, Goldin and Rouse (2000) have found that blind auditions reduce gender discrimination in hiring women musicians.

We find that blind interview procedures (like telephone interviews) can reduce beauty premium by 40% (due to elimination of direct stereotype effects).

Elimination of oral interaction can eliminate beauty premium completely. Too drastic…

What We Don’t Know Is taste based discrimination present in repeated

relationships? Do students care more about physical attractiveness

than older human resource officers? Are employers over-interpreting visual and audio

stimuli because those can be productive in most other environments?

Can we design an experiment in which self-confidence of workers is payoff-relevant for employers?

Is underperformance of females in part due to different responses to goal-setting?
